La vie d'Othon est connue par les biographies de Suétone et de Plutarque , complétées par les annales de Tacite et celles de Dion Cassius. Ses ancêtres étaient originaires du bourg de Ferentium. Né en 32 apr. J.-C. à Ferentium en Étrurie , Marcus Salvius Otho est issu d'une famille de notables de la gens Saluia. Sa famille a depuis longtemps des liens étroits avec la Domus Augusta, la famille impériale. WebOtto II, (born 955—died Dec. 7, 983, Rome), German king from 961 and Holy Roman emperor from 967, sole ruler from 973, son of Otto I and his second wife, Adelaide. Otto, a cultivated man, continued his father’s policies of promoting a strong monarchy in Germany and of extending the influence of his house in Italy.
